SMITHLEY READY FOR THE DESERT

AVONDALE, Ariz. – Garrett Smithley hopes to improve on his finish in Phoenix International Raceway’s spring Xfinity Series race in Saturday’s Ticket Galaxy 200.

Smithley finished 31st in PIR’s first Xfinity race of the year.

“We’re bringing a good car to Phoenix,” Smithley said. “We’re definitely looking for better results this go-round. The track is smooth and fast – a really fun track to race.”

Smithley will drive the ETC Custom Truck Accessories Chevrolet Saturday.

Practice is scheduled at 12:30 and 4:30 p.m. Friday. Qualifying is set for 4:15 p.m. Saturday, with the race to follow at 7:30.
